STARTING&DRIVING
HillDescentControl(HDC)
TheHDCsystemisonlyanauxiliary
function.Ithaslimitationswhensubjectto
adverseconditionssuchaswetoricysurfaces
andsteepslopes.TheHDCsystemcannot
overcomethelawsofphysics,alwaysensure
thatthevehicleisdrivendownsteepslopes
atlowspeeds.
EvenwhentheHDCsystemisswitchedon,
thedrivermustalwayspaycloseattention
tothedrivingstateofthevehicle,andtake
activecontrolwhennecessary.Incertain
cases,HDCmaybesuspendedorswitched
offtemporarily.
Duringsomedrivingconditionsondownhill
surfaces(e.g.drivingdownaslopewith
highspeed,theslopeislessthan10%,etc.),
HDCisinoperative,thedrivermustmaintain
controlofthevehicleatalltimesanduse
brakeapplicationstoensuresafety.
TheHDCsystemisanauxiliaryfunctionspeciallydesigned
fordrivingonacutedownhillgradients.Thesystem
reducesthespeedbyapplyingbrakeforce,thusassisting
thedrivertodriveonacutedownhillsurfaceswithlow
speeds.
PleaseDONOTusethisfunctionwhendrivingonthe
ordinaryroads.
WhentheHDCisworking,thebrakesystemmayemita
strongvibrationornoise.Itisnormalduringtheoperation
ofHDC.
Note:Duringtheoperationofhilldescentcontrol
(HDC)system,pleasedonotswitchtheshiftleverto
"N"position.SuchoperationmaydeactivatetheHDC
function.
